
Delta Dental PPO is a prominent dental insurance plan that offers a wide range of benefits to its members. This plan is designed to provide comprehensive dental coverage while allowing flexibility in choosing dental care providers. The PPO (Preferred Provider Organization) model enables members to receive services from a network of dentists who have agreed to provide care at reduced rates.
This structure not only helps in managing costs but also ensures that members have access to quality dental care. The Delta Dental PPO plan typically covers preventive services, such as routine check-ups and cleanings, at 100%. Basic services, including fillings and extractions, are usually covered at a lower percentage, while major services, such as crowns and root canals, may require a higher out-of-pocket expense.

Co-pays and deductibles are integral components of dental insurance plans, including Delta Dental PPO. A co-pay is a fixed amount that members pay for specific services at the time of treatment. For instance, a member may have a $20 co-pay for a routine check-up or a higher co-pay for more complex procedures like root canals or crowns.
Deductibles represent the amount members must pay out-of-pocket before their insurance coverage kicks in for certain services. Understanding these financial responsibilities is crucial for effective budgeting and planning for dental care expenses. Members should review their policy documents to clarify their specific co-pay amounts and deductible requirements, ensuring they are prepared for any upcoming dental visits.

Delta Dental PPO plans typically have an annual maximum limit on benefits paid per member per year. Understanding this limit is crucial for effective financial planning regarding dental care. Members should keep track of their expenses throughout the year to ensure they do not exceed this maximum before year-end.
To make the most of annual maximums, consider scheduling necessary treatments strategically throughout the year rather than waiting until the end of the benefit period. This approach allows members to utilize their benefits fully without incurring excessive out-of-pocket costs in a single year. Additionally, if you anticipate needing extensive work in the upcoming year, discussing this with your dentist early on can help create a comprehensive treatment plan that aligns with your insurance coverage.

### FAQ Section 1. **What services are covered under Delta Dental PPO?**
– Delta Dental PPO typically covers preventive services at 100%, basic services at varying percentages (usually 70-80%), and major services at lower percentages (often 50%). 2.
**How do I find an in-network provider?**
– You can find an in-network provider by using the provider search tool on the Delta Dental website or by contacting customer service for assistance. 3. **What should I do if my dentist is not in-network?**
– If your preferred dentist is not in-network, you may still receive care but will likely incur higher out-of-pocket costs.
Consider discussing this with your dentist about potential adjustments or seeking an alternative provider within the network. 4. **Are orthodontic treatments covered?**
– Many Delta Dental PPO plans include orthodontic coverage; however, it may be subject to specific limitations or waiting periods.
5. **What happens if I exceed my annual maximum?**
– If you exceed your annual maximum limit on benefits, you will be responsible for any additional costs incurred beyond that limit until the next benefit period begins. 6.
**Can I appeal a denied claim?**
– Yes, if a claim is denied, you have the right to appeal the decision by following the claims appeal process outlined in your policy documents. 7. **How often should I visit my dentist?**
– It is generally recommended to visit your dentist every six months for routine check-ups and cleanings to maintain optimal oral health.
8. **What are some common exclusions in Delta Dental PPO plans?**
– Common exclusions may include cosmetic procedures (like teeth whitening), certain experimental treatments, or services rendered outside of network providers without prior authorization. 9.
**How do I manage my deductible?**
– To manage your deductible effectively, keep track of your expenses throughout the year and schedule necessary treatments strategically to meet your deductible without exceeding it unnecessarily. 10. **What should I do if I need major dental work?**
– Consult with your dentist about necessary major work and obtain an estimate detailing costs covered by Delta Dental PPO before proceeding with treatment.
